Our ideal candidate for a Lead Estimator is someone who has 10 + years of mechanical estimating experience. Primary responsibilities for iSuit e's Lead Estimator i nclude: Analyzing each project before it starts and accurately estimating costs related to labor, materials, equipment and other relevant areas based on drawings and specifications. Reviewing and comprehending technical and administrative documents such as Change Orders, Requests (COs) for Proposals (RFPs) and Requests for Quotes (RFQs). Compiling complete estimates while working with a team of estimators (piping, plumbing and sheetmetal) to ensure a complete and accurate bid. Determining lists of material takeoffs to define quantities of materials necessary to complete a system. Determining work crews and production rates for performance of required tasks. Breaking down the scope of work into definable tasks. Assisting in the development of bids, scope documents and proposals. Developing pricing changes to existing projects. Developing and maintaining relationships with subcontractors and suppliers. These relationships should have a level of trust and respect from subcontractors and vendors to ensure best numbers on bid day-therefore maintaining relationships with subcontractors and suppliers is crucial. Being well versed in computerized takeoff programs including Autodesk ESTmep or QuoteSoft as well as capable of manual entry, digitizer and on-screen takeoff methods.
